To get energy from wind, we must focus on a concept known as kinetic energy. Due to micro-climate situations, wind is produced fairly readily in a natural process. The sun heats the ground at different rates. In areas where the ground is heated faster, the air rises as temperatures go up. The air from cooler ground will rush in to fill the gap. We catch the air in wind turbines and turn it into energy. The wind will be caught by a spinner’s blades, and when the spinner turns, a generator will cranked to produce electricity. This process is natural and simple, but produces a monstrous amount of energy. If it were possible to get all the wind in the world, the energy produced will be 10 times the amount we have now. But harnessing it is the problem.
There are a number of reasons why wind power is part of our energy solution. First of all, there are no pollution or greenhouse gases involved. Second, it is renewable and will last for as long as our son – about another four billion years. It’s also available anywhere. Last, wind power can produce more energy than all the other energy platforms.
Wind power is growing in use and popularity in places such as Germany and China. In the United States, California has three large wind farms that are used to provide power during massive energy use periods in the summer. The process is viable, but we must accept it and pursue better technology to wring the most out of the huffing and puffing of Mother Nature.
